A component speaker system gives you the best possible performance from your car audio system. A system consists of separate woofers, tweeters, and crossovers, each designed to cover one specific range of frequencies. As separate components, the woofer can move freely to deliver more powerful performance, while the tweeter can be custom-mounted in a better spot up closer to your ears, revealing a whole new world of detail. Separate crossovers are far superior to the simple filters wired into full-range speakers, so the components work together for smoother, more focused sound. Infinity's Reference component speaker systems feature smooth good looks and even smoother sound!These systems use a full edge-driven textile dome tweeter a high performance tweeter design found on upper-end home speakers, not the W-dome (or balanced dome) tweeter commonly found in car speakers. A larger tweeter voice coil translates into increased power handling and less distortion at high output levels. Highs are clean, accurate, and free from harshness. Infinity's intelligent "I-Mount" system allows for flush-, angle-, or surface-mounting of the tweeters.The Reference 6000cs component system features a 6-1/2" Plus One+ woofer (even larger than the previous Plus One cone) for increased output. The injection-molded polypropylene driver is lightweight, durable, and highly accurate; its hi-roll rubber surround provides smooth woofer excursion and long-term performance. The 2-way crossover includes 3,500 Hz high-pass and low-pass filters. Woofers Tweeters Crossovers Woofers Plus One+ Woofer Cones: Each speaker uses a cone significantly larger than other speakers of the same size. This is accomplished by using a new basket design and hi-roll surround. The Plus One+ design offers greater bass output and a significant increase in efficiency. Woofer Materials: Each woofer is constructed from Injection-Molded Polypropylene. This process of cone molding assures a uniform cone thickness for superior linearity and clarity. It is also lighter weight and more rigid for decreased distortion and improved bass response. Hi-roll Rubber Surrounds: The hi-roll rubber surrounds allow the woofers a greater range of movement, resulting in longer X-max and more bass output. Tweeters Tweeter Material: Each tweeter features a 1" edge-driven textile dome for smooth, accurate highs. I-Mount Tweeter Mounting System: The tweeters can be surface-, angle-, or flush-mounted with Infinity's innovative I-Mount system: Surface Mount: Surface mounting the tweeters involves screwing the surface-mount cup to the mounting location, then inserting and locking the tweeter into the cup. Angle Mount: Surface mounting the tweeters at an angle involves screwing the angled surface-mount bracket to the mounting location, then attaching the surface-mount cup to the angled surface-mount bracket. Next, insert and lock the tweeter into the surface-mount cup. Flush Mount: Flush mounting is made easy through the use of the threaded flush-mount adapter and plastic locking nut. Once a cutout is made, the flush-mount adapter (with the tweeter installed) is inserted into the hole. The large plastic locking nut is threaded onto the adapter (from behind the mounting surface) to hold the complete assembly securely in place. When flush mounted, the tweeters may be angled for optimum response and imaging. Tweeter Mounting Dimensions: Surface Mount Angle Mount Flush Mount Mounting Height 0.934" 1.643" 0.504" Depth 0.538" (screw depth) 0.482" (screw depth) 1.229" Frame Diameter 1.646" 1.631" 1.998" Cutout Diameter NA NA 1.759" Crossovers 2-Way Crossovers: These speakers include computer-optimized, voice-matched crossovers. Each crossover features an 18dB/octave, 3.5kHz high-pass network for the tweeter and an 18dB/octave, 3.5kHz low-pass network for the woofer. Crossover Connections: The crossover inputs and outputs are gold-plated screw terminals. Mounting: There are two mounting holes in the base of each crossover.
